Largest Available Lawler and Nearby Studio Apartments

The largest available Studio apartment unit in Lawler, IA is found at Falls Edge Studios and is 487 square feet priced from $995. Park Avenue Lofts The Temple in the Downtown Waterloo neighborhood has the second largest Studio, which is sized at 480 square feet and currently listed start at $1,100. Here is today’s list of the largest available Studio units in Lawler:

Cheapest Available Lawler and Nearby Studio Apartments

As of August 20, 2026 the lowest priced Studio apartment unit in Lawler, IA is the Studio Model starting from $695 at Russell Lamson in the Downtown Waterloo neighborhood. The second most affordable Lawler Studio is the Studio E Model at Falls Edge Studios starting at $995 . The average price for all Studio apartments in Lawler is currently $1,118. Quick Rent Budget Calculator

How much rent can you afford?

The common "Rule of Thumb" is that rent should be no more than 30% of your income. How much is that? Enter your monthly income and click "Calculate My Budget" to find out.

Frequently Asked Questions about Studio Lawler Apartments

What is the Cheapest apartment in Lawler with Studio?

Currently the most affordable Studio in Lawler is at Russell Lamson listed at $695.

How much is the average rent for a Studio Lawler Apartment?

The average rent for a Studio Apartment in Lawler is $1,118.

What is the largest available Studio Lawler Apartment for rent?

Today's apartment with the most square footage in Lawler is a 487 square feet unit starting from $995 at Falls Edge Studios.

What is the average size for Lawler Studio Apartments for rent?

The average size for a Studio rental in Lawler is currently 416 sq ft.
